عمل نسخ احتياطية من سطر الأوامر في نظام التشغيل Mac OS X باستخدام هذه الحيل الأربعة

Anonim

في هذه الأيام لا يوجد نقص في طرق النسخ الاحتياطي لماكنتوش الخاص بك. ربما تكون الطريقة الأكثر شيوعًا المتاحة للمستخدم النهائي هي Apple's Time Machine والتي يتم التعامل معها تلقائيًا بعد إعداد بسيط من خلال واجهة المستخدم الرسومية ، أو يمكن تشغيلها للبدء في أي وقت. شخصيًا ، لقد تأثرت كثيرًا بسهولة الاستخدام التي توفرها Time Machine ، لكنني مدمن لسطر الأوامر ، لذا يجب أن أقدم تقريرًا عن البدائل المتاحة ، أربعة منها موجودة في سطر الأوامر ذاته في نظام التشغيل Mac OS X.

اقرأ بعض الطرق المختلفة التي يمكنك استخدامها في Terminal لنسخ جهاز Mac احتياطيًا ، باستخدام ditto و rsync و asr و hdiutil.

1) كما هو الحال

sudo ditto -X src_directory dst_directory

Ditto هو جزء مدمج من نظام التشغيل Mac OS X ويتم شحنه بجميع الإصدارات. Ditto قوي إلى حد ما ويمكنه نسخ ملفاتك احتياطيًا مع الاحتفاظ بسمات الملكية وشوكات الموارد. إحدى الميزات الرائعة التي يقدمها Ditto هي القدرة على "تقليل" ثنائيات PPC أو كود i386. على سبيل المثال ، إذا كنت تمتلك PPC Macintosh أقدم ، فيمكنك إضافة –arch ppc إلى خيارات سطر الأوامر وسيتم تجريد كل ملف ثنائي تم نسخه احتياطيًا من الرمز الثنائي x86 الخاص به. سينتج عن ذلك نسخ احتياطية أصغر.

2) rsync

sudo rsync -xrlptgoEv - التقدم - حذف src_directory dst_directory

Rsync هي طريقة متعددة الاستخدامات وشائعة لإجراء عمليات النسخ الاحتياطي ليس فقط على نظام التشغيل Mac ولكن على خوادم Linux و Unix عبر "عالم تكنولوجيا المعلومات".يمكن لـ Rsync القيام بكل ما تحتاجه لإجراء نسخة احتياطية موثوقة لنظام OS X الخاص بك ، بما في ذلك شوكات الموارد والحفاظ على قدرة محرك الأقراص الثابتة الخاص بك على أن يكون "قابلاً للتمهيد". يمكن الاطلاع على نظرة متعمقة لقدرات rysnc هنا.

3) asr

sudo asr -source src_directory -target dst_directory -erase -noprompt

asr ، أو الأداة المساعدة "Apply Software Restore" هي طريقة أخرى ممتازة وفعالة لإجراء النسخ الاحتياطي. يمكن لـ ASR القيام بكل ما يمكن أن يفعله Ditto بالإضافة إلى أن لديه القدرة على نسخ القرص الصلب على مستوى الكتلة. مستوى الكتلة هو "أدنى" نموذج ممكن للوصول إلى القرص الصلب ويوفر نسخًا حقيقيًا بنسبة 100٪ للبيانات. يجب تنفيذ وظيفة مستوى الحظر في ASR على الأقراص الثابتة غير المثبتة حاليًا في نظام التشغيل الخاص بك. يعني هذا عادةً التمهيد من قرص استرداد أو تثبيت USB أو ما شابه.

4) hdiutil

sudo hdiutil create dst_image.dmg -format UDZO -nocrossdev -srcdir src_directory

إذا كنت ترغب في إنشاء نسخة احتياطية بسيطة وملف واحد من جهاز Macintosh الخاص بك ، فإن hdiutil يناسبك. يقوم Hdiutil بإجراء نسخة احتياطية إلى ملف صورة قرص واحد (مضغوط اختياريًا) يمكن استعادته باستخدام برنامج Disk Utility من Apple.

عمل نسخ احتياطية من سطر الأوامر في نظام التشغيل Mac OS X باستخدام هذه الحيل الأربعة